Mini Digger vs. Skid Steer for Land Preparation

When tackling {land clearing , the selection between a compact digger and a skid loader machine is critical . Often, a mini excavator shines when dealing with heavy vegetation, stones , and irregular terrain , offering superior excavation power and precision . However, a skid loader excels in scenarios requiring high adaptability and easy pile movement. Therefore, the “best ” machine copyrights on the particular project and the challenges it poses .
